Output 891f46a16df8c0fb1ab6d774d0e71a7f1e8d2c816bd2d7752104b28db0b427af:1

value
1275532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1d4e91e43206a8e5e5d87861af220a9233d17a1 OP_EQUAL
address
3LpWCvdHKQWHqfVDACQFXdHR1epU7ovVuD
transaction
891f46a16df8c0fb1ab6d774d0e71a7f1e8d2c816bd2d7752104b28db0b427af
confirmations
269464
spent
true